# Run ART APEX tests.
SCRIPT_DIR=$(dirname $0)
# Status of whole test script.
exit_status=0
# Status of current test suite.
test_status=0
function say {
echo "$0: $*"
}
function die {
echo "$0: $*"
exit 1
}
function setup_die {
die "You need to source and lunch before you can use this script."
}
[[ -n "$ANDROID_BUILD_TOP" ]] || setup_die
[[ -n "$ANDROID_PRODUCT_OUT" ]] || setup_die
[[ -n "$ANDROID_HOST_OUT" ]] || setup_die
flattened_apex_p=$($ANDROID_BUILD_TOP/build/soong/soong_ui.bash --dumpvar-mode TARGET_FLATTEN_APEX)\
|| setup_die
# Switch the build system to unbundled mode in the reduced manifest branch.
# TODO(b/159109002): Clean this up.
if [ ! -d $ANDROID_BUILD_TOP/frameworks/base ]; then
export TARGET_BUILD_UNBUNDLED=true
# Flattening is not supported in unbundled mode, regardless what
# TARGET_FLATTEN_APEX says.
flattened_apex_p=false
fi
have_debugfs_p=false
if $flattened_apex_p; then :; else
if [ ! -e "$ANDROID_HOST_OUT/bin/debugfs" ] ; then
say "Could not find debugfs, building now."
build/soong/soong_ui.bash --make-mode debugfs-host || die "Cannot build debugfs"
fi
have_debugfs_p=true
fi
# Fail early.
set -e
build_apex_p=true
list_image_files_p=false
print_image_tree_p=false
print_file_sizes_p=false
function usage {
cat <<EOF
Usage: $0 [OPTION]
Build (optional) and run tests on ART APEX package (on host).
-B, --skip-build skip the build step
-l, --list-files list the contents of the ext4 image (\`find\`-like style)
-t, --print-tree list the contents of the ext4 image (\`tree\`-like style)
-s, --print-sizes print the size in bytes of each file when listing contents
-h, --help display this help and exit
EOF
exit
}
while [[ $# -gt 0 ]]; do
case "$1" in
(-B|--skip-build) build_apex_p=false;;
(-l|--list-files) list_image_files_p=true;;
(-t|--print-tree) print_image_tree_p=true;;
(-s|--print-sizes) print_file_sizes_p=true;;
(-h|--help) usage;;
(*) die "Unknown option: '$1'
Try '$0 --help' for more information.";;
esac
shift
done
# build_apex APEX_MODULES
# -----------------------
# Build APEX packages APEX_MODULES.
function build_apex {
if $build_apex_p; then
say "Building $@" && build/soong/soong_ui.bash --make-mode "$@" || die "Cannot build $@"
fi
}
# maybe_list_apex_contents_apex APEX TMPDIR [other]
function maybe_list_apex_contents_apex {
local print_options=()
if $print_file_sizes_p; then
print_options+=(--size)
fi
# List the contents of the apex in list form.
if $list_image_files_p; then
say "Listing image files"
$SCRIPT_DIR/art_apex_test.py --list ${print_options[@]} $@
fi
# List the contents of the apex in tree form.
if $print_image_tree_p; then
say "Printing image tree"
$SCRIPT_DIR/art_apex_test.py --tree ${print_options[@]} $@
fi
}
function fail_check {
echo "$0: FAILED: $*"
test_status=1
exit_status=1
}
# Test all modules, if possible.
apex_modules=(
"com.android.art.release"
"com.android.art.debug"
"com.android.art.testing"
)
if [[ "$HOST_PREFER_32_BIT" = true ]]; then
say "Skipping com.android.art.host, as \`HOST_PREFER_32_BIT\` equals \`true\`"
else
apex_modules+=("com.android.art.host")
fi
# Build the APEX packages (optional).
build_apex ${apex_modules[@]}
# Clean-up.
function cleanup {
rm -rf "$work_dir"
}
# Garbage collection.
function finish {
# Don't fail early during cleanup.
set +e
cleanup
}
for apex_module in ${apex_modules[@]}; do
test_status=0
say "Checking APEX package $apex_module"
work_dir=$(mktemp -d)
trap finish EXIT
art_apex_test_args="--tmpdir $work_dir"
test_only_args=""
if [[ $apex_module = *.host ]]; then
apex_path="$ANDROID_HOST_OUT/apex/${apex_module}.zipapex"
art_apex_test_args="$art_apex_test_args --host"
test_only_args="--flavor debug"
else
if $flattened_apex_p; then
apex_path="$ANDROID_PRODUCT_OUT/system/apex/${apex_module}"
art_apex_test_args="$art_apex_test_args --flattened"
else
apex_path="$ANDROID_PRODUCT_OUT/system/apex/${apex_module}.apex"
fi
if $have_debugfs_p; then
art_apex_test_args="$art_apex_test_args --debugfs $ANDROID_HOST_OUT/bin/debugfs"
fi
case $apex_module in
(*.release) test_only_args="--flavor release";;
(*.debug) test_only_args="--flavor debug";;
(*.testing) test_only_args="--flavor testing";;
esac
fi
say "APEX package path: $apex_path"
# List the contents of the APEX image (optional).
maybe_list_apex_contents_apex $art_apex_test_args $apex_path
# Run tests on APEX package.
$SCRIPT_DIR/art_apex_test.py $art_apex_test_args $test_only_args $apex_path \
|| fail_check "Checks failed on $apex_module"
# Clean up.
trap - EXIT
cleanup
[[ "$test_status" = 0 ]] && say "$apex_module tests passed"
echo
done
[[ "$exit_status" = 0 ]] && say "All ART APEX tests passed"
exit $exit_status
